Abstract: | Background The major difficulty in postoperative care in patients after craniotomy is to distinguish the intracranial deficits from the
residual effect of general anesthesia. In present study, we used cerebral state index (CSI) monitoring in patients after craniotomy
with delayed recovery, and evaluated the prediction probability of CSI for long-term postoperative unconsciousness. |
